Output c23d7c41dc64a01c1f7743b381ea2a9366380efcbecb4b9de3aba357f0a4240e:0

value
10833976
script pubkey
OP_HASH160 OP_PUSHBYTES_20 693348b621d3f22ac56b4c9aaddf774a4b3abde4 OP_EQUAL
address
3BHGJxnyYfxzk71YVjANh4PBQhgWzkcKY4
transaction
c23d7c41dc64a01c1f7743b381ea2a9366380efcbecb4b9de3aba357f0a4240e
spent
true